About this opportunity
We are looking for a Senior Program Manager to join our PDU PMO team in Canada. The team consists of approximately 15 members and is responsible for planning and delivering Product R&D releases on time,
within scope, and with high quality.

In this role, you will lead large-scale software development programs (>50 people across multiple teams) and play a key part in driving how we deliver products to market. You will work closely with Product Management,
R&D, Release Management, and other stakeholders e.g. Service Delivery and Market Area team to secure successful delivery of our product roadmap to the customers.

This role could be based in Brazil.

What you will do:

  • Lead and manage end-to-end software development programs (>50 people), from initiation through delivery and closure
  • Own program planning, including scope, timelines, milestones, and resource alignment across Agile teams/ARTs
  • Drive Product R&D release execution, ensuring on-time delivery to agreed scope, quality, and budget
  • Coordinate dependencies across teams and domains, identifying and managing risks, issues, and impediments early
  • Facilitate Agile/SAFe ceremonies at program level (e.g., PI planning, system demos, inspect & adapt) in collaboration with RTEs and line managers
  • Provide clear, data-driven program status reporting and communication to stakeholders and leadership
  • Support and/or drive organizational change initiatives needed to meet market and industry needs (ways of working, tooling, governance)
  • Foster a culture of continuous improvement, collaboration, and accountability across the program
  • Ensure compliance with Ericsson processes, quality standards, and security requirements
